In 2024 the School of Music (‘the School’) may offer an award known as the Dr Rosalind Dubs Companion Recurring Bursary for Cello.
The objective of the Award is to provide increased access and financial support to commencing and continuing music performance students displaying outstanding potential in classical cello, and to accompany the use of the Dr Rosalind Dubs cello.
Funding for this Award has been provided by Dr Rosalind Dubs.

The recipient of the Award must agree to the terms of a standard loan agreement to take possession of the instrument.
The value of the Award is $2,000 per year for up to four years, as well as the use of the Dr Rosalind Dubs cello.
